标签:
1.增加代码可读性-------注释、语义话标签
2.提高代码重用性-------公共组件和私有组件的维护
设计公用组件时需要考虑让接口保持弹性,并且高度模块化,多处重复使用不允许轻易被修改,有专人维护必要时需要提供规范的API文档和演示DEMO,这是考验能力和经验的工作。
3.尽可能的减少冗余和精简代码
Js中,Jquery将所有的组件全放放在一个文件里,通过尽可能精简的代码和优秀的算法,“加载和使用方便”的同时往“精简”靠拢;而YUI将组建按功能分成一个个不同的文件,在页面中只根据需求加载相关的文件。这种按需加载的loader方式对用户友好,“精简”的同时往“加载和使用方便”靠拢
4.磨刀不误砍柴工------前期的构思很重要
构思主要内容:规范的制定、公共组件的设计和复杂功能的技术方案等。
5。团队沟通交流
标签:
原文地址:http://www.cnblogs.com/alice-fee/p/5471044.html